Sorry guys - forgot to run upgrade_MailScanner_conf (yeah, pillock!)

Mind you - now I have...

Dec  1 14:36:31 chichester MailScanner[12720]: MailScanner E-Mail Virus
Scanner version 4.48.4 starting... 
Dec  1 14:36:32 chichester MailScanner[12720]: Could not read file
/etc/MailScanner/reports/en/rejection.report.txt 
Dec  1 14:36:32 chichester MailScanner[12720]: Error in line 865, file
"/etc/MailScanner/reports/en/rejection.report.txt" for rejectionreport does
not exist (or can not be read) 

I have created the file and we seem to be starting up now. 

(This is from the RedHat rpm install)
